I practiced using Elvenlabs to change the voice from your vanilla Lydia voice mod to IDF's voice. All you need is these:
MultiXwm (for this mod/XWM files) and YakitoriAudioConverter v1.4(For Lucien mod/fuz files ) and ofc you need accont with subs at elevenlabs.io and it cost the first time 1.24€ // and you have to find IDF Lydia voice sample, I found on youtube.
And now I replaced your mod files with my own edited files and renamed them same as your files names so them should work fine, I hope.
The project took about two hours on my own because there were over 80 Lydia voice files for Inigo so I recommend you try Lucien first, there are only three files to edit.
Edit: Well it worked, sort of, but the voice was really quiet.
Edit2: Now I got it works! (Maybe I added too many decibels by Audacity but at least you can hear Lydia's voice now) Now with Lucien
